Renal function analysis Spectrometrical enzyme primarily based assays were utilised to meas ure plasma and urine creatinine and plasma urea. Glom erular filtration rate was calculated subsequently within the basis on the corresponding urine volume and is expressed as ml per minute per a hundred g body excess weight. Histology and immunohistochemistry All microscopic examinations had been performed within a blinded fashion as previously reported. For histo logical examination, cortical tissue was fixed in Carnoys solution. 3 um sections of paraffin embedded tissue had been stained with periodic acid Schiff to analyze tubulointerstitial and glomerular fibrosis by a pc primarily based morphometric examination.

Renal sections have been examination ined on a Leica DM LB2 light microscope connected to a PL A662 video camera and also the Axiovision 2. 05 image ana lysis system using a 10 × ten orthographic grid overlaid on digital images. The relative degree of tubulointerstitial fi brotic lesions, i. e. matrix deposition, tubular atrophy and dilation was selleck calculated in 15 randomly selected cortical places per animal observed at ×200 magnification. It’s expressed as percentage from the area impacted in relation to the complete spot analyzed. Glomerular matrix expansion was evaluated by calculating the relative degree of the mesangial matrix occupying location of 15 glomeruli from every rat.

Renal myofibroblast differentiation, macrophage infiltra tion and cell proliferation were analyzed on paraffin embedded tissues incubated using a principal mouse anti SMA or ED1 antibody in conjunction with a regular APAAP technique, and using a major mouse purchase C59 wnt inhibitor anti PCNA antibody and also a secondary goat anti mouse antibody coupled together with the Envision staining technique, as previously described. Immunohistochemistry for detecting style I collagen was performed through the use of goat anti kind I collagen pri mary antibody. Like a secondary antibody, horse radish peroxidase conjugated rabbit anti goat antibody was utilized and visualized with AEC reagent. Renal collagen I deposition, myofibroblast differentiation, macrophage infiltration and cell proliferation evaluated by collagen and SMA good staining, ED1 and PCNA positive cells, respectively in at the very least 15 glomerular sections and at the very least 15 randomly picked cortical places from every single rat observed at ×200 magnification. Collagen I depos ition and myofibroblast have been expressed as percentage per place by applying the histomorphometric computer primarily based Axiovision 4. one picture examination program.
